ECM Operating Conditions Sensed

1983 Chevrolet Sportvan G10, 5.7 LSECTION ECM Operating Conditions Sensed
  • A/C "ON" or "OFF"
  • Engine Coolant Temperature
  • Ambient Temperature
  • Barometric Press. (BARO)
  • Brake "ON" or "OFF"
  • Cruise Control "ON" or "OFF"
  • Differential Press. (Eng. Vacuum)
  • Distributor Reference
  • Crankshaft Position
  • Engine Speed
  • EGR Vacuum
  • Engine Cranking
  • Engine Detonation (ESC)
  • Exhaust Oxygen (O2)
  • Manifold Absolute Press. (MAP)
  • Mass Air Flow (MAF)
  • Manifold Air Temperature (MAT)
  • Park/Neutral Sw. Position (P/N)
  • System Voltage
  • Throttle Position (TPS)
  • Transmission Gear Position
  • Vehicle Speed (VSS)
